4.3.1.2. Yellow target LED
A040266
Fig. 4.3.1.2.-1 Yellow target LED
*
Target off:
No protection element has picked up and there are no thermal alarms.
*
Lit target:
A protection element has picked up or generated an alarm. The pickup and alarm
target can be selected to be either latching or non-latching with the SGF
switches. A non-latching target is automatically cleared when the fault has
disappeared and the protection element has been reset, whereas a latching target
remains lit until manually cleared.
*
Flashing target:
Pickup protection elements have been blocked by an external digital input signal.
The blocking target is non-latching, that is, it disappears with the digital input
signal.
The yellow target LED continues flashing for as long as a protection element
remains blocked. The blocking target disappears with the digital input signal or
when the protection element is no longer picked up.
If a protection element is blocked when other protection elements are picked up, the
target continues flashing. This is because a blocking target has a higher priority than
a pickup target.
